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52030 10483 5673306974 31 56
48593393492 7927997434 360772
48593393492 7927997434 360772
99 69 123424252 13246459
All about undefined
Interested in learning more?
48593393492 7927997434 360772
99 69 123424252 13246459
See more
0164149 509612
533927 13 40194
See more
53 17
0643 2457 195
See more